Commit 764b8868 by lzxry

1

parent fda84c42
......@@ -2706,8 +2706,8 @@ public class ContractServiceImpl implements ContractService {
s_data[w] = false;
}else{
s_data[w] = true;
filter.put("validStartDate",formatter.formatCellValue(row_data.getCell(14)).trim());
}
filter.put("validStartDate",formatter.formatCellValue(row_data.getCell(14)).trim());
filter.put("one_time",dataSTR);
}else {
//主账号不为空,按照之前逻辑不变
......@@ -2766,20 +2766,20 @@ public class ContractServiceImpl implements ContractService {
String start_date = filter.get("start_date");
String end_date = filter.get("end_date");
String rowIndex = filter.get("rowIndex");
String validStartDateStr="";
if(filter.get("one_time").equals("否")){
validStartDateStr = start_date;
}else{
validStartDateStr = filter.get("validStartDate");
}
String validStartDateStr = filter.get("validStartDate");
//if(filter.get("one_time").equals("否")){
if(!StringUtils.isEmpty(validStartDateStr)){
DateTime dateTime = new DateTime(validStartDateStr);
DateTime startDate = new DateTime(start_date);
DateTime endDate = new DateTime(end_date);
int contractAllDay = Days.daysBetween(startDate, endDate).getDays();//合同总天数-1 ,用于计算结束日期
filter.put("valid_start_date",dateTime.toString("yyyy-MM-dd"));
filter.put("valid_end_date",dateTime.plusDays(contractAllDay).toString("yyyy-MM-dd"));
if(filter.get("one_time").equals("否")){
filter.put("valid_end_date",end_date);
}else{
int contractAllDay = Days.daysBetween(startDate, endDate).getDays();//合同总天数-1 ,用于计算结束日期
filter.put("valid_end_date",dateTime.plusDays(contractAllDay).toString("yyyy-MM-dd"));
}
}else{
return ResultModel.ERROR("第" + rowIndex + "行主账号【" + email + "】未填写IP发送");
}
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ment